Alex Evans (born 18 August 1989) is a British model. In July 2008 she was announced as the winner of Cycle 4 of Britain's Next Top Model.

The ten photo shoots were divided into two parts, first was Company Magazine test shots while the second was Max Factor Beauty Shots. Alex failed to bring a stellar photograph just like the past few weeks, and her Company Magazine test shot was criticized for losing her neck. Although she was praised for her Max Factor Beauty Shot, Alex ended up in the bottom two with the eventual runner-up Catherine. In a surprise twist, both of them survived and moving to South Africa.
The eleventh photo shoot was all about African Tribe Couture, and the girls posing with an African warrior. This week Alex once again comes out of her shell, producing a stellar photograph but criticized for working her mouth disgustingly. However, she was called first and nailed to the top three.
The final photo shoot had the girls posing with some South African creatures, and Alex had to pose with an iguana. Although at first she was too slow, eventually she turned out a stellar photograph. The judges were impressed with how she brought herself to the photo shoot and they no longer saw her as the shortest girl. For the third time she was called first and so advanced to the finale.
After everything was completed, the judges were discussing Alex and Catherine. Both of them did very well in the runway show, and their portfolios were also improving. After a very tough deliberation, Alex was crowned as Britain's Next Top Model.
As part of her prize, she received a contract and representation with Models 1 New Faces division, a fashion spread, and cover for Company Magazine and a contract with Max Factor cosmetics. She appeared on the cover of the September 2008 edition of Company Magazine.
She appeared in the October 2008 edition of Maxim Magazine as the cover girl.[1]
In 2009 she appeared on the cover of Your Hair Magazine. Evans has also featured in Max Factor print work, and a Radio advert for a Make Up competition. She recently landed her own TV advert for the Nintendo Wii game "Another Code R".
In May 2010 she featured in a TV advert for Superdrugs Barry M makeup line.
She walked in the live final of Britain's Next Top Model series 6.
In October 2010 she was a part of the Yeo Valley advertising campaign which saw a two minute rap played on TV and thus she had a part in the rap.
She is currently working at Nevs Modelling Agency London.
In April 2011 she appeared in the music video of 'Down Down Down' by Charlie Simpson, a former member of Busted.
She currently lives in London. Previously, she attended Prior's Field School and Godalming College where she studied Theatre Studies, English Literature and Psychology A-level.[citation needed]
